IT'S FOOTBALL SEASON

The Maryland Terrapins will host six Saturday games and one Friday game at Maryland Stadium. The information below relates to parking and shuttle service for the Saturday games.

If you plan to attend a game, we strongly recommend that you purchase your permits in advance of game day. Online prepay permits are $27-$47, depending on the game tier. Parking permits may be purchased on-site while space is available for $32-$52, depending on the game tier.

If you don't plan to attend the game but need to visit campus during a home game, we recommend you become acquainted with your parking options.

Individuals who park on campus—including students, faculty, staff and visitors—should review our game day vehicle relocation requirements, as almost all campus lots are reserved for football on home game days.

GAME DAY PERMIT OPTIONS

SINGLE GAME PERMITS

Single game permits purchased in advance of the game are $27-$47, depending on the game tier. Parking options available for pre-paid permits are viewable on our football parking map.

Fans who arrive on campus on game day without a parking permit will only be able to purchase parking at street-side meters or in lots while space is available for $32-$52, depending on the game tier. Both of these parking options are available on a first-come, first-served basis.

SEASON TICKET HOLDERS

Season ticket holders receive game day parking permits through the athletics ticket office. Additional parking permits may be purchased through DOTS. 

TERRAPIN CLUB SCHOLARSHIP FUND PARKING

Terrapin Club members receive game day parking permits through the athletics ticket office. Visit the Terrapin Club website for additional information.

ADA ACCESSIBLE PARKING

ADA accessible parking is available via the north entrance of Stadium Drive Garage (SDG). You may purchase an online permit for any football lot and display both your online pre-paid permit and your disability license plate or placard to park in SDG. ADA parking in SDG is also available on a first-come-first-serve basis on game days without a permit purchased online in advance, but additional fees may apply to parking sold on-site as opposed to purchased in advance.

Vehicles MUST have a disabled license plate or placard to enter an ADA accessible parking area.  

Requests for additional information regarding disabled parking and paratransit should be sent to transportation@umd.edu 72 hours prior to game day. 

Gameday Paratransit service is available for all home football games. Please see the Gameday Paratransit section below.

GAME DAY CAMPUS ROAD CLOSURES

Stadium Drive between the Stadium Drive Garage North entrance and Regents Drive Garage North entrance as well as Fieldhouse Drive between Union Lane and Lot Z will close from 4 hours prior to each game kickoff to 2 hours after the end of the game.

There will be no east-west thoroughfare during this closure. Game day permit holders should access their lots from the following campus entrances:

At University Blvd. and Stadium Dr.
Stadium Drive Garage, Lots LL4, YC, Z

Adelphi Rd. and Campus Dr.
Lots 1, 1b, 1c, 1d, 1f, 3, A, JJ2, MV, O1, O3

At University Blvd. and Paint Branch Dr.
Lots 4b, 4j, 9b, 11b, 11b RV & Bus, CC1, FF2, P1, P2, PH, Terrapin Trail Garage, UU, XX1, XVL

At Baltimore Ave and Campus Dr.
Lots GG1, L, R2, R3, Regents Drive Garage, Union Lane Garage

At Baltimore Ave. and Rossborough Ln.
Lot C1

QUICKBUS AND SHUTTLE-UM ON GAME DAY

Quickbus is Shuttle-UM's free service that transports you from your parking lot or the College Park Metro Station to Maryland Stadium. You can view the route and stops on the football parking map.

Quickbus operates from

  • Three hours prior to kickoff
  • Until one hour after the final whistle

Quickbus Loops include

  • North Shuttle: Serves Regents Drive Garage and Blue Zone lots.
  • South Shuttle: Serves Green and Yellow Zone lots, as well as downtown College Park.
  • College Park Metro Station: Serves the College Park Metro Station.

All loops drop off and pick up at Cumberland Hall circle, which is a 7-minute (0.3 mile) walk to the stadium. Buses are available at this location during the game and after the game for your return trip.

ACCESSIBILITY

Buses on each loop are a mixture of ADA accessible and non-ADA accessible vehicles. However, we offer paratransit service to accommodate all guests. For information regarding paratransit service on game day, please see the Gameday Paratransit section below.

SHUTTLE-UM SERVICE CHANGES DURING GAMEDAY

With the exception of the 104 College Park Metro route, Shuttle-UM Evening Service routes, do not run until about an hour after the conclusion of the game. Please check the Transit App for real-time information about affected routes.

GAMEDAY PARATRANSIT

On-demand Service Vehicle

Paratransit vans can seat one guest using a wheelchair and up to two companions. Vans are available on a first-come, first-served basis and cannot be reserved in advance. To request a ride, simply visit a van at Hagerstown Hall (Lot N9), College Park Metro Station, or the Quickbus Hub. For assistance, call 301-314-3687.
